WebJan 10, 2024 · Mandarin Tongue Twister: “4, 10, 14 and 40”. Maybe you have already heard about this tongue twist because it’s quite famous. Besides the combinations of the numbers sì (四 – four) and shí (十 – ten) with shì (是 – and), a lot of foreigners also have a problem to differentiate between sì (四 – four) and qī (七 – seven).

Chinese tongue twisters 🤪 the boys throughly enjoyed it and keep … chubu foodWebThis tongue twister has become a classic in Hong Kong and was one of the most successful McDonald's marketing strategies in the 80's. Anyone who managed to finish these sentences within five seconds in front of the service desk in the restaurant would get a Quarter Pounder with Cheese free. 一蚊一斤龜,七蚊一斤雞。. chubu flight
